pull out

US /pʊl aʊt/
UK /pʊl aʊt/
"pull out" picture
1.

mencabut, menarik keluar

to extract or remove something from a place or position

:
He had to pull out a splinter from his finger.
Dia harus mencabut serpihan dari jarinya.
The dentist will pull out your wisdom tooth.
Dokter gigi akan mencabut gigi bungsu Anda.
2.

mundur, menarik diri

to withdraw from an activity, agreement, or competition

:
The company decided to pull out of the deal.
Perusahaan memutuskan untuk mundur dari kesepakatan.
The team had to pull out of the tournament due to injuries.
Tim harus mundur dari turnamen karena cedera.
3.

keluar, bergerak

for a vehicle to move away from the side of the road or from a line of traffic

:
The car slowly began to pull out into traffic.
Mobil itu perlahan mulai keluar ke lalu lintas.
He checked his mirrors before pulling out of the parking spot.
Dia memeriksa spionnya sebelum keluar dari tempat parkir.
